I agree we should have come out with our third drive by KeoughCharles05

on our first two (though looking back, we did try on the second drive to establish the run. That series went run, run, pass, run, run, run, punt.)

But I'm not sure that we were just trying to run the clock down in the second half. Down 21-7, we were moving the ball, and the play that turned the game into garbage time was a pick where Book was actually trying to be aggressive for once.

Starting at the 10 yard line, we threw three times, and ran three times (one of those was a Book run that I think was a scramble, so call it 2 runs and 4 passes). Then we threw the pick on 2nd and 7. It looked like a balanced drive trying to move the ball the way we could. And down 14 early in the half, it was an approach that made sense. Assuming we got to within 7, we were still going to need another stop or an extra possession to get the game to a tie.

Down 28-7, we had an ugly drive that involved a roughing the passer penalty, a 14 yard sack, and Drew Pyne being inserted into the game with 2nd and 24. Hard to read too much into what the approach was here.

Then we got the ball back down 31-7 early in the 4th. That drive had 8 passes and two runs (one of which was a Book scramble, the other of which was a 7 yard run by Williams to pick up a first down on 2nd and 2). We went 62 yards in 10 plays in 4 minutes. Not exactly lightning, but also not an intentionally slow drive. This was the drive with the illegal shift taking away the TD.

The following drive we went 80 yards in 14 plays with 13 designed passes, and one designed run.
